Property Line Clearing in Atlanta, GA
Property line clearing services involve the removal of trees, shrubs, and other vegetation along the boundaries of a property to establish clear and defined property lines. These projects often include trimming or removing overgrown foliage, clearing brush, and creating open space to improve visibility, access, and overall property organization. Homeowners typically request this service when preparing for boundary disputes, planning landscaping projects, or ensuring that neighboring vegetation does not encroach on their land.
Before requesting property line clearing, property owners should understand the boundaries of their property, including any legal or survey markers that define the limits. It is also important to consider the extent of vegetation to be removed, the potential impact on existing landscaping, and any local regulations or restrictions related to tree removal or land clearing. Clear communication about project scope and desired outcomes can help ensure the work aligns with property goals and compliance requirements.
